Pregunta

¿Cómo hago el botón "orden de cambio" aparece en SharePoint 2010?

He seguido una guía que me ha permitido añadir OrderedList="TRUE" a mi plantilla de lista. Esto hace que sea posible seleccionar "Permitir a los usuarios artículos de la orden en este punto de vista" para mi punto de vista. Pero el botón de orden de cambio sigue desaparecido. Cualquier idears en lo que me falta?

Estoy utilizando SharePoint 2010 y la guía es de 2.006, lo que podría explicar por qué no lo hace solo trabajo.

La guía de tech-archive.net .

¿Fue útil?

Solución

He creado una pequeña aplicación de consola para ayudarme a configurar el atributo OrderedList.

class Program {

    public static SPSite GetAdminSPSite() {
        SPSite spsite = null;
        SPSecurity.RunWithElevatedPrivileges(delegate() {
            spsite = new SPSite("http://sharepointdev");
        });

        return spsite;
    }

    static void Main(string[] args) {

        if (args.Length != 2) {
            Console.WriteLine("Missing sitename parameter and the list name.");
            return;
        }

        string sitename = args[0];
        string listname = args[1];

        using (SPSite site = GetAdminSPSite()) {

            using (SPWeb web = site.OpenWeb("ClientSites/" + sitename)) {

                SPList list = web.Lists[listname];
                list.Ordered = true;
                list.Update();

            }
        }

    }
}

Una vez que se ejecuta entonces usted necesita para modificar la vista como dice @ Jeff Smith.

Otros consejos

No está seguro de si se trató de esto ya, pero en SP 2007 después de implementar su lista de añadir el atributo OrderedList = TRUE, todavía se necesita para modificar la vista y bajo la clasificación verá una nueva opción "Permitir al usuario ordenar artículos en esta vista". El botón "Orden de Cambio" no aparece hasta que se establezca que la opción "Sí".

Licenciado bajo: CC-BY-SA con atribución
No afiliado a StackOverflow
scroll top